China’s soybean crush volume in the week ended Friday August 2 rose by 100,000 tonnes from the previous week to 2.07 million tonnes while the country’s soymeal stocks continued to be at a record high, according to the latest figures from the China National Grain & Oils Information Center (CNGOIC).
